The disclosure relates to the field of electronic cigarette preheating technology, more particularly to an electronic cigarette preheating control method and preheating control system.
The electronic cigarette usually heats and vaporizes liquid substances or paste-like substances, such as drugs and cigarette liquid, to generate aerosol or vapor for users to use. As people pay more attention to their health, they realize that tobacco may be harmful to health. Thus, the electronic cigarettes are widely used.
Existing electronic cigarette usually comprises cigarette liquid and a heating device for vaporizing the cigarette liquid. The cigarette liquid may be stored inside the liquid storage chamber. During vaporization, the cigarette liquid stored inside the liquid storage chamber may be permeated or fed to the heating device. Usually, when an electronic cigarette is turned on to operate, no preheating control method or procedure is provided to warm up the electronic cigarette. In particular when the electronic cigarette is used in cold winter or at cold areas such as higher latitudes or higher elevations, the viscosity of the cigarette liquid or tobacco tar or liquid substances containing drugs of the electronic cigarette is increased and the fluidity thereof is reduced at low temperature. In such a case, it is not easy for the cigarette liquid or drugs to be permeated or fed to the heating device for vaporization, such that the vapor can hardly be produced when the electronic cigarette initially starts. To this end, it is desired to provide a preheating control method which preheats the cigarette liquid or liquid substances containing drugs by means of the heating device during power-on self-test of the electronic cigarette, to facilitate production of the vapor.

According to an electronic cigarette preheating control method, setting preheating parameters and a preheating routine in a microcontroller MCU arranged in the electronic cigarette, performing data interaction by a communication connection established between an intelligent terminal and the electronic cigarette, and displaying and changing the preheating parameters on a control software interface of the intelligent terminal. The preheating parameters at least comprise preset temperature value, and preset heating time or preset target temperature value. The preheating routine comprises: when the electronic cigarette is turned on, sending preheating parameters changed on the control software interface to the microcontroller MCU to replace previous preset preheating parameters; detecting real-time temperature value by means of a temperature detection unit arranged in the electronic cigarette; by means of the microcontroller MCU, comparing the real-time temperature value with the preset temperature value and determining whether preheating of the cigarette liquid stored inside the liquid storage chamber is required or not, if no, directly entering an available stand-by state of the electronic cigarette, if yes, controlling the heating device arranged in the electronic cigarette by means of the microcontroller MCU to perform heating for the preset heating time or until the preset target temperature value is reached, and then ending the preheating and entering the available stand-by state of the electronic cigarette. Herein, the temperature detection unit may be configured to detect temperature by detecting a resistance value of the thermistor heating coil of the heating device to calculate the real-time temperature value.
Preferably, the control software interface may be configured with a preheating switch. When the preheating switch is turned off, sending an instruction of stopping preheating to the electronic cigarette by means of the intelligent terminal, and then stopping the preheating routine by means of the microcontroller MCU such that the heating device of the electronic cigarette is controlled to not preheat or stop preheating.
Preferably, when the microcontroller MCU determines the preheating is required, controlling the LED indicator light arranged on the electronic cigarette by means of the microcontroller MCU to emit light for warning. When the preheating is finished, controlling the vibrator arranged on the electronic cigarette by means of the microcontroller MCU to provide vibration for warning.
Preferably, the preset heating time may be a constant value or set as a function which is inversely proportional to the real-time temperature value. That is, the lower the real-time temperature value, the longer the period of the preset heating time.
Preferably, the preheating parameters may further comprise preset preheating power. The preset preheating power may be a constant value or set as a function which is inversely proportional to the real-time temperature value. That is, the lower the real-time temperature value, the greater the preset preheating power.
Preferably, the preheating parameters may further comprise preset stand-by time. After the electronic cigarette enters the available stand-by state, the electronic cigarette will automatically shut down if the electronic cigarette detects that the user does not take even a puff within the preset stand-by time.
Preferably, the microcontroller MCU may be configured to recurrently detect real-time temperature and determine whether the preheating is required again or not within the preset stand-by time, if yes, controlling the heating device of the electronic cigarette by means of the microcontroller MCU to perform heating again.
Preferably, the communication connection established between the intelligent terminal and the electronic cigarette may be wireless Bluetooth connection, or wireless WIFI connection, or wireless radio frequency (RFID) connection, or USB wired connection.
Preferably, the intelligent terminal may be a desktop computer, or a laptop, or a tablet computer, or a smartphone.
Preferably, the preset temperature value may be set to a range of −10° C.˜10° C., the preset heating time may be set to a range of 1˜5 seconds or the preset target temperature value may be set to a range of 10° C.˜80° C., and the stand-by time may be set to a range of 5˜10 minutes.
Preferably, the preset preheating power may be a constant value set to a range of 2 W˜6 W.

The electronic cigarette preheating control method and preheating control system according to the disclosure achieve parameter setting and controlling by the communication connection established between the intelligent terminal and the electronic cigarette. The electronic cigarette is installed with automatic preheating control routine. After detecting real-time temperature, the electronic cigarette is capable of automatically determining whether preheating is required. The heating device of the electronic cigarette is used to perform heating and generate heat energy. As the heat energy is transferred to the liquid storage chamber of the electronic cigarette, the cigarette liquid or liquid substances containing drugs may be preheated such that the viscosity may be reduced and the fluidity may be increased. In this way, even when the electronic cigarette is used in cold winter or at cold areas such as higher latitudes or higher elevations, the cigarette liquid or tobacco tar or liquid substances containing drugs of the electronic cigarette may be preheated at such low temperature, facilitating the cigarette liquid or drugs to penetrate or flow to the heating device of the electronic cigarette for vaporization. Hence, the electronic cigarette may produce vapor even at low temperature.

The cigarette liquid stored inside the liquid storage chamber according to the disclosure may be flowable cigarette liquid, or tobacco tar having poor fluidity or waxy solid formed by solidification of tobacco tar, or liquid substances containing drugs or waxy solid formed by solidification of drug liquid, etc.
The temperature detection unit comprises the heating coil of the heating device. The heating coil of the heating device according to the disclosure may be made of the thermistor having its resistance varied with a change in temperature. The higher the temperature, the higher the resistance, i.e., the change in resistance is proportional to the change in temperature. In this way, the temperature of the heating coil may be determined by detecting the resistance of the heating coil.
